The 500MW Abydos Solar PV Plant has officially begun operations, marking a significant step forward in AMEA Power’s renewable energy efforts. The plant is a key component of AMEA Power’s expanding portfolio of clean energy projects, including solar, wind, and energy storage initiatives, in Egypt.

Egypt remains a crucial market for AMEA Power, which continues to lead the clean energy transition in the region. The successful launch of the Abydos Solar PV Plant strengthens the company’s commitment to advancing renewable energy solutions across Africa, the Middle East, and Asia.

This milestone also highlights the growing demand for clean energy infrastructure across Africa, the Middle East, and Asia, where AMEA Power is actively involved in advancing projects that support energy security, reduce carbon emissions, and foster economic development.
